First Up.......The Gallery

If you look up to the top most grey strip on the right side of the screen, you'll see a whole bunch of tabs including blogs, gallery, chat room, etc. If you've never clicked the gallery tab, do it now, trust me.

If you go into the members Gallery, there is just a ton of cool stuff waiting for you. Members have loaded up pictures of their collections, trips to cons, custom figures, and random images that they think are cool. I think one of the coolest sections is "Unproduced Figures" that has the original prototype pictures of Mayweather's Helm, Salt Vampire, Ferengi Borg and the Romulan Senator. I go there every now and then just to think about what could have been!

The best part of all this is you can set up your own gallery too. Since I already have an album set up, I have a "My Album" tab next t "My Controls" on the second grey strip at the top. To set up a new album, you'll have to go to "My Controls" and on the left tool bar there will be a link that says "Your Albums." If you click that you should get a message reading "No Albums Found" but you in luck because it also gives a link to "Create your first album"! Go through the setup process, make sure to put it in the members Gallery, and make sure to CHECK THE PUBLIC BOX! That way everyone can see it. Once you have it created you can start uploading.

The image upload is very easy to do and doesnt take much time. Once you go to your album either through the gallery or through the new "My Albums" tab all you have to do is click "NewImage" and follow the easy steps for uploading.

This is a really cool feature on this site especially for customizers because it gives a quick access point to both your collection and your creations without having to navigate threads. OK now that we know how to build a gallery, lets move onto something that everyone can use frequently.

Trektoy Schematics #2: How to Check Posts the Easy Way

You've probably have noticed those flashing red lights on the TOS Skin (you can change skins down at the very bottom of the page but all skins have some variation of the same theme). You've probably also realized that those flashing red lights represent new posts. Lets say though that you are on your new iPhone and can't really navigate through all the forums like you would on your PC or laptop. Well all you have to do is click the "View New Posts" tab on the secong gray bar at the top next to "My Controls" and your brand spankin' new "My Albums" that you developed a few days ago! This will take you to a screen that shows you all of the new posts that have been written since your last visit.

Lets also say that all those flashing red lights are giving you a headache. You can also "mark all posts as read" by clicking the tab of the same name that appears at the bottom of the page on the blue bar right under the last forum, Random Thoughts. By clicking that you can get rid of all the flashing but you will no longer know what is new so be careful with that button!

Have you updated your profile lately?

After looking through some of our profiles. I realized how few of us actually have it up to date or even have info in there at all. To make this a closer knit community here are a few ways to add some extra info into your profile to let us get to know each other a little better:

1. All the editing can be done through the "My Controls" tab on the upper command bar.
2. Go to Edit Profile Information and thre you can do the follwoing:
a. add a persoanl picture (if you feel comfortable with it)
b. add a list of interests
c. double check to make sure your gnder, birthday, and location are all correct
d. you can also add in any instant messenger IDs or your own personal website address
3. If you go to personal portal information you can add a persoanl statement

If you explore further, there are a lot of other cool things you can do in the controls section and please let me know if I've missed something!
